Prey Strike Kinematics
Loligo vulgaris
Loligo captures prey by ballistic tentacle launch in ~30 ms. High-speed video quantifies launch latency, peak velocity, and accuracy of the tentacular strike.

Quantitative Output
Measured Parameters
Every parameter is automatically tracked frame-by-frame in the ConductVision pipeline for Loligo vulgaris.
| Parameter | Unit | Description |
|---|---|---|
| Strike latency | ms | Cue to tentacle launch |
| Peak tentacle velocity | m/s | Maximum launch speed |
| Strike accuracy | % | Successful prey contact |
| Approach distance | BL | Body-lengths to target before strike |
